A new interview sheds light on how one student at Marjory Stoneman Douglas High School feels about the media’s coverage of the horrific tragedy that took place at his school.

In an interview with The Daily Wire published Monday, Brandon Minoff said that the media was exploiting the shooting to push for gun control.

“They exploit everything to make it political,” he explained. “They’re more concerned about gun control at this moment rather than the fact that there were 17 people that were killed.”

That’s probably not something that CNN or MSNBC would like to hear.

Multiple commentators in the establishment media aggressively pushed for gun control in the wake of the shooting.

MSNBC host Joe Scarborough smeared people who don’t support new gun control as “domestic terrorist enablers.” He also called them “useful idiots.” (RELATED: MSNBC’s Scarborough Labels Opponents Of Gun Control ‘Domestic Terrorist Enablers’ And ‘Useful Idiots’)

CNN’s Don Lemon also said that people who don’t want to “talk about guns” in the wake of the shooting need to “shut up.”

Minoff also said, “It pains me to see that knowing that 17 of my classmates are dead and they just want to talk about gun control.”

“Students have opinions, they say stuff that they’re against guns, and that gun control is necessary, but they’re making it bigger than it needs to be at this moment.”
